怎样往allegro里加封装
时间: 2023-09-14 12:05:38 浏览: 57
往 Allegro 中添加封装需要以下步骤:
1. 创建一个新的 C++ 类来封装 Allegro 的功能。这个类应该包含 Allegro 的头文件,并且应该有一个构造函数和一个析构函数。
2. 在构造函数中,初始化 Allegro 库。你需要调用 al_init() 和其他必要的函数来设置 Allegro 库的参数。
3. 在析构函数中,清理 Allegro 库。你需要调用 al_uninstall_system() 和其他必要的函数来释放 Allegro 库所占用的资源。
4. 在你的封装类中添加对 Allegro 函数的包装。对于每个 Allegro 函数,你需要编写一个包装函数来调用这个函数,并在必要时转换参数和返回值。
5. 在你的封装类中添加其他函数和数据成员,以便你可以更方便地使用 Allegro 的功能。
6. 最后,将你的封装类编译成一个库,以便其他人可以使用它。
需要注意的是,Allegro 的功能非常广泛,因此在封装时可能需要选择一个特定的子集来封装。另外,由于 Allegro 是一个跨平台的库,因此你需要确保你的封装代码可以在所有支持的平台上运行。
相关问题
怎样往allegro里加PCB封装
要往Allegro里添加PCB封装,需要执行以下步骤:
1. 打开Allegro软件,并创建一个新的PCB设计文件。
2. 在Design菜单中选择“Padstack Manager”选项。
3. 在Padstack Manager窗口中,选择“New Padstack”选项,然后输入新的封装名称并单击“OK”按钮。
4. 在“Padstack Properties”窗口中,选择适当的形状和尺寸,并设置针脚位置和排列方式。
5. 单击“OK”按钮以保存新的Padstack封装。
6. 在PCB设计文件中使用新的Padstack封装。
7. 如果需要,可以使用“Padstack Manager”窗口中的“Edit Padstack”选项来对已有的Padstack进行修改。
以上是基本的添加PCB封装的步骤,具体操作可能会因版本差异而略有不同。
allegro 通孔封装
Allegro通孔封装是一种用于电子元件的封装类型,通常用于印刷电路板(PCB)设计中。这种封装类型在PCB上使用通孔连接器来连接电子元件与PCB电路层之间的连接。通孔封装通常包括一个金属套筒,通过通过孔穿过PCB并与电子元件的引脚焊接连接。
Allegro通孔封装是由Cadence Design Systems开发的,它是一种常见的PCB设计软件。该软件提供了各种通孔封装选项,可以满足不同类型的电子元件需求。
使用Allegro通孔封装可以确保电子元件的稳定连接和可靠性,同时也有助于简化PCB设计和制造过程。在进行PCB设计时,需要根据具体元件的尺寸、引脚间距和布局要求选择合适的Allegro通孔封装。
总而言之,Allegro通孔封装是一种常见的PCB设计封装类型,用于在PCB上连接电子元件和电路层。